Schakowsky and colleagues call on Speaker Ryan to disband the Select Panel on Planned Parenthood

In the wake of the Colorado Springs Planned Parenthood shootings, Democratic members of Congress including Jan Schakowsky (D-IL), Bonnie Watson Coleman (D-NJ), Diana DeGette (D-CO), Suzan DelBene (D-WA), Jerrold Nadler (D-NY) and Jackie Speier (D-CA), called upon Speaker Paul Ryan (R-WI) to disband what they term a partisan committee formed to investigate Planned Parenthood. 

The joint statement condemned the attack on the Planned Parenthood clinic that killed three and expressed the representatives' condolences to the victims' families. The representatives condemned the violence toward women's health centers that perform abortions. They reminded Speaker Ryan that it is unacceptable for women to be afraid to go to the doctor.

“Three Congressional committees have already investigated Planned Parenthood based on videos manufactured by an ideological organization that opposes safe and legal abortion services, and Republican Chairman Jason Chaffetz has admitted that there is no evidence that Planned Parenthood has broken any laws," the representatives said. "Rather than spending millions more taxpayer dollars on another special Benghazi-like committee to reinvestigate inflammatory and baseless allegations, Congress should turn its attention to ensuring that women get the vital and legal health care services that they need. We call on Speaker Ryan to disband the 'Select Panel to Attack Women’s Health.' ”
